IISER TVM JRF Recruitment 2025 :- The Indian Institute of Science Education and Research (IISER) Thiruvananthapuram, a premier institute established by the Government of India, has announced an exciting opportunity for young researchers. Under the IISER TVM JRF Recruitment 2025, the institute is inviting applications for the position of Junior Research Fellow (JRF) on a contract basis. This IISER TVM JRF Recruitment 2025 is for a Department of Biotechnology (DBT) funded project titled “Understanding the role of energy producing pathways on hematopoietic emergence in mouse”. This is a perfect opportunity for motivated post-graduates in life sciences to gain valuable research experience in a top-tier scientific environment.

  • Research Area: This JRF position is in the field of developmental biology and hematopoiesis, specifically investigating how energy metabolism influences blood cell formation in mouse models.
  • Nature of Post: The appointment is purely temporary and co-terminus with the project. There is no provision for absorption into regular positions at IISER TVM after the project ends.
  • Location: The position is based at the prestigious IISER Thiruvananthapuram campus in Kerala.

The selection will be based on the following steps:

  1. Application Scrutiny: Received applications will be screened by a selection committee based on academic credentials, statement of interest, and relevance of experience.
  2. Shortlisting: Only shortlisted candidates will be contacted via email for the next stage, which is likely an Online Interview.
  3. Interview: Shortlisted candidates will be interviewed to assess their subject knowledge, research aptitude, and suitability for the project.
  4. Final Selection: The final selection will be made based on the candidate’s overall performance in the interview and their qualifications.

Note: No TA/DA will be provided for attending the interview.

Interested and eligible candidates must submit their applications via email only by following these steps:

  1. Prepare Application Package: Compile all the following documents into a single PDF file:
    • Detailed Curriculum Vitae (CV): Include sufficient information on past research work.
    • Statement of Interest: A one-page write-up explaining your interest in biological research.
    • Contact Details: Email address and phone number.
    • Recent Photograph
    • Scanned Copies of all educational/professional qualification certificates.
    • Reprints of Research Articles (if any).
    • Referee Details: Name and contact details of two referees who can comment on your academic and technical abilities.
  2. Send Email: Send the compiled PDF application to pasobiology@iisertvm.ac.in.
  3. Email Subject Line: The subject of the email must be formatted as: “Application for DBT sponsored HSC project: [Your Name]”.
  4. Deadline: The application must be received on or before 10th October 2025. Incomplete applications will be rejected.

After Selection: The selected candidate will be required to submit hard copies of the application form and original documents for verification upon joining.
